Blackwatch Armed Forces, Commanded by the Venerable Blackwatch Six (Blackwatch Council OF-10)
Blackwatch's military is primarily a ground force organization, with a supporting air force and navy wing. Rather than treating Space and the craft that ply it as a navy type of organization, Blackwatch instead treats it as if a break off of the Air force, called Space Force, with Spacemen replacing the term Airmen, but otherwise structured similarly. All spacecraft are called such, and there are no real references to spaceships in Blackwatch records unless dealing with others and their translations.

Rank, Uniforms and Insignia
There are only 7 Ranks in Blackwatch forces, Grades 1-7, with Grades 1-3 Being Enlisted, Grade 4 being Non-commissioned officers, grades 5-7 being officers. Titles such as Captain, Colonel and others are used to allow ease of integration with the rest of the Federation their forces, and with their recent close working relationship with the Federation, to establish a hierarchy with in their own ranks, IE a captain of a company and a Lt. Colonel in charge of a battalion may both be Grade 5 officers, but one usually has displayed greater leadership abilities or tactical acumen and would thus considered a higher rank even though they are both the same Grade.
- Enlisted
- Grade 1 - Basic Recruits and Recent Graduates. Knows enough to get their job done but still needs individual training at their units to integrate into their tactics properly. Usually those under 1 year of service.
- Grade 2 - Knows enough to get their job done in their unit, and is capable of performing whatever missions their unit is capable of. Beginning to start specialized training in whichever position they are best suited for, IE: Heavy Weapons (Launchers, LMGS, Grenadier, etc). Usually has a service of 1-3 years.
- Grade 3 - Specialists. Subject matter experts in their field, capable of training new recruits and bringing them up to speed. Are trained to become Squad, Fireteam and other similar small leadership roles. Usually 3+ years.
- Non-Commissioned Officers
- Grade 4 - Those that have displayed proper leadership are promoted to Grade 4, where they are now official Non-Commissioned officers. They can lead up to an entire company, though most of the time they are leaders of a Platoon or a group of Platoons. Usually 4+ years of experience, though if one displays leadership qualities before the usual 4 years they can be recommended for promotion straight to Grade 4 as early as 2 years of experience.
- Officers
- Grade 5 - Commissioned officer, capable of commanding a company or in rare cases a battalion or in rarer cases a brigade, has to have had experience with in the other Grades or equivalent experience in another military or paramilitary organization. They are still expected to be on the ground, in the fight, and must go through everything their men do alongside them. Generally a specialist or Non-commissioned officer who is promoted due to their leadership capabilities.
- Grade 6 - Commissioned officer, usually seen commanding a battalion, more often a brigade or a division. The last position that actually participates directly in battle, this is generally where officers will spend the rest of their fighting days at.
- Grade 7 - Commissioned officer, generally seen commanding a brigade, division, corp or group. Usually the men promoted to this Grade are battle-hardened individuals that have shown remarkable leadership qualities and strategic acumen. There are those that will turn down a promotion to this level as they are expected at this point to no longer participate in battle and run things strictly from a strategic level.
Uniforms -
- Standard Uniform - The Standard for Blackwatch uniforms are a dark grey nearly black in color, with symbols being in black and white.
- Standard Armor - Dark grey armor cover their legs and a breastplate embossed with a red sun leave their arms bare. Black tribal paint covers every flat surface of their armor is jagged lines, all radiating from the central depiction of a helmet and mask done up in red.
- Council Units - Every member of the Blackwatch Council has the ability to field their own units, these units are specially designated with a Gold Sash, Gold paint on their vehicles and/or Gold On their uniforms. A unit that is not of the Council's personell units are not allowed to wear Gold in any form outside of special awards.
